The Origin and Antiquity of Our English Weights and Measures Discovered: By Their Near Agreement with Such Standards That Are Now Found in One of the Egyptian Pyramids is a book written by John Greaves in 1745. The book explores the history and origins of English weights and measures, arguing that they can be traced back to ancient Egypt. Greaves draws comparisons between English standards and those found in the Great Pyramid of Giza, suggesting that the English system of measurement may have been influenced by ancient Egyptian practices. The book provides a detailed analysis of various weights and measures used in England, including those used for currency, trade, and everyday life. It also includes illustrations and diagrams to help readers understand the various systems of measurement.
